使用dev分支作为开发分支,release分支作为发布分支,master分支作为生产分支,feature分支作为有大变化新功能开发分支,hotfix分支作为生产代码bug修复分支。feature分支以dev为基础,功能开发完成合并到dev;dev分支代码测试完成,dev合并到release分支;release分支测试完成合并到master分支;master分支验证完成,上生产环境;生产环境有bug,以master分支为基础,建立hotfix分支,修改完成后,合并到dev、release、master分支,验证完成后上生产环境。
分享团队使用的git分支流程:
最新推荐文章于 2024-08-24 22:26:52 发布
本文介绍了一种软件开发中常用的分支管理策略:使用dev分支进行日常开发,release分支用于发布准备,master分支代表稳定版本,feature分支专为新功能研发,hotfix分支则针对线上紧急修复。
使用dev分支作为开发分支,release分支作为发布分支,master分支作为生产分支,feature分支作为有大变化新功能开发分支,hotfix分支作为生产代码bug修复分支。feature分支以dev为基础,功能开发完成合并到dev;dev分支代码测试完成,dev合并到release分支;release分支测试完成合并到master分支;master分支验证完成,上生产环境;生产环境有bug,以master分支为基础,建立hotfix分支,修改完成后,合并到dev、release、master分支,验证完成后上生产环境。
646

被折叠的 条评论
为什么被折叠?



